Signs of Present Time

In today’s Gospel reading, Jesus contrasts his contemporaries’ knowledge and understanding of the nature with their inability to understand the importance of his presence among them. With all their knowledge, they are still unable ‘to interpret the present time.’ The present time is the time to recognize what God is doing in their midst. Jesus has provided much evidence of God’s saving activity. But they have not responded well and have not perceived that Jesus is establishing the reign of God. Jesus admonishes them for their worldly concerns. In the present time, Jesus is calling everyone to actively participate in establishing God’s kingdom on earth.  We are to realize that the kingdom is growing among us. Jesus invites us to be wise in discerning the signs of this kingdom. He is calling everyone to action; it is nothing but our commitment to the kingdom of justice. As followers of Christ we must be committed to action but have to cope with our frequent failure to live our faith. Failures are common in our commitment to God’s kingdom, but nevertheless we believe that God will do something good through us.
